What is the Texas Antique Vehicle Insurance Exemption Affidavit?

The Texas Antique Vehicle Insurance Exemption Affidavit is a crucial document for antique vehicle owners, certifying that their vehicle qualifies as a collector's item due to its age. Specifically, vehicles that are 25 years or older can benefit from this affidavit, as it exempts them from certain insurance requirements.
This exemption not only reduces insurance costs, but it also streamlines the process of registering antique vehicles for collectors who enjoy showcasing them. To qualify, the vehicle must be used purely for leisure, rather than regular transportation.

Who Needs the Texas Antique Vehicle Insurance Exemption Affidavit?

The Texas Antique Vehicle Insurance Exemption Affidavit is intended for antique vehicle owners and collectors. This includes individuals who own vehicles that are 25 years old or older and use them solely for exhibitions or parades, not for daily driving.
Additional qualifications may apply, particularly concerning vehicle condition and registration status, emphasizing the importance of this document for legitimate owners.

Individuals owning a vehicle that is at least 25 years old and classified as an antique can use this affidavit to certify their vehicle's status for insurance exemption.
While there is no specific submission deadline for the affidavit itself, it is recommended to submit it promptly when applying for antique license plates to avoid delays.
After completing and notarizing the affidavit, submit it in person to your county tax assessor-collector’s office. Ensure you have all supporting documents ready.
You may need to provide proof of vehicle ownership, such as a title or registration, along with the notarized affidavit when applying for antique license plates.
Common mistakes include incomplete fields, incorrect vehicle information, and failure to obtain notarization. Double-check your entries before submission.
Processing times can vary by county but typically takes a few weeks. It’s best to inquire directly with your local tax assessor-collector's office for specific timelines.
